WordPress作为全球最流行的内容管理系统之一,其注册和登录页面是网站与用户互动的第一道门户。一个设计精良、功能完善的注册登录页不仅能提升用户体验,还能有效提高用户转化率。本文将详细介绍WordPress默认注册登录页的功能特点,以及如何通过插件和代码自定义这些页面。
一、WordPress默认注册登录页概述
WordPress系统自带基本的用户注册和登录功能,通过/wp-login.php页面提供标准化的界面。默认情况下,这个页面包含:
- 用户名和密码输入框
- “记住我”选项
- 忘记密码链接
- 注册新账户链接(如果网站开放注册)
虽然功能完整,但默认界面设计简单,缺乏个性化元素,难以与品牌形象保持一致。
二、为什么要自定义注册登录页
- 品牌一致性:统一的视觉设计增强专业形象
- 用户体验优化:简化流程,减少用户流失
- 安全增强:添加验证码等安全措施
- 功能扩展:集成社交媒体登录等额外功能
- 转化率提升:通过优化设计提高注册率
三、自定义注册登录页的常用方法
1. 使用专业插件
- Theme My Login:完全重写登录页面外观
- Ultimate Member:提供完整的用户管理系统
- User Registration:创建多步骤注册表单
- Social Login:添加社交媒体登录选项
2. 通过主题文件自定义
在主题的functions.php文件中添加代码可以修改默认行为:
// 修改登录页面logo链接
function my_login_logo_url() {
return home_url();
}
add_filter( 'login_headerurl', 'my_login_logo_url' );
// 修改登录页面logo标题
function my_login_logo_url_title() {
return '您的网站名称';
}
add_filter( 'login_headertext', 'my_login_logo_url_title' );
3. CSS样式定制
通过添加自定义CSS可以改变登录页面的视觉效果:
body.login {
background-color: #f1f1f1;
}
.login h1 a {
background-image: url('your-logo.png');
width: 200px;
height: 100px;
background-size: contain;
}
四、注册登录页安全最佳实践
- 启用SSL加密所有表单提交
- 添加reCAPTCHA验证防止机器人注册
- 限制登录尝试次数防止暴力破解
- 使用强密码策略
- 考虑启用双因素认证
五、移动端优化建议
随着移动设备访问量的增加,注册登录页的移动友好性变得至关重要:
- 确保输入框大小适合触控操作
- 优化键盘弹出行为
- 保持页面加载速度快
- 测试不同屏幕尺寸下的显示效果
通过以上方法,您可以打造一个既美观又实用的WordPress注册登录页面,既满足品牌需求,又能提供流畅的用户体验,最终实现更高的用户转化率。